Rural Intelligence Kids
If you have a child who’s interested in musical theater, consider sending them to this year’s Musical Theatre Workshop run by Edgar Acevedo under the auspices of the Mac-Haydn, Chatham’s famous theater in the round. For 24 years, local elementary school teacher and theater buff Acevedo and his staff of professional directors, choreographers, and vocal instructors have been welcoming kids from ages 6 to 16 to the Chatham Fairgrounds for an energetic summer camp experience.

Kids explore all aspects of musical theater in age-appropriate groups: acting, singing, dance, theater games and improvisation are all on the menu. The youngest actors perform in musicals adapted for their age based on familiar children’s stories such as Stone Soup and The Three Little Pigs. Students ages 9 to 16 are cast in two musicals and receive training in singing, dancing, and acting. Previous musical productions include: Seussical Jr. and The Pirates of Penzance

The 6 to 9 age group meets July 5 to July 28, with classes Monday through Thursday from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. Classes for ages 9 through 16 will meet July 5 to August 8, Monday through Thursday from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. (2 p.m. on Thursday).
